The National Gallery is collaborating with the London Film School on 'Transcriptions: LFS Shorts', an innovative new project which involves 2nd term students producing short 3-4 minute films inspired by the Gallery's collection as part of their course.

Patterns

by Hena Chowdhury

From the Film Maker...

My film takes the building blocks of shots, fragments them and puts them together to create a whole. You can recognize the individual building blocks just as you can make out the identity of the fragmented objects in the painting.

I interpret Picasso's painting to be the figure of a woman playing a violin as if it were a guitar. The figure's formed from inanimate objects. It made me think of an artist surrounded by objects that inspire her. For the artist in my film, her imagination, reality and the objects in her house are interconnected. This inspires her work.
